Luis Buñuel SpainA fierce critic of Catholic doctrine, Buñuel's surrealist films systematically deconstruct religious dogma and institutional hypocrisy through provocative, dreamlike imagery.
Pier Paolo Pasolini ItalyHis films interrogate the tension between Marxist ideology and Christian theology, questioning what constitutes heresy in both political and spiritual domains.
